Swintt has pointed to Germany as its next destination of igaming expansion after agreeing to a content partnership with Jackpotpiraten.de

Tapping into another corner of the German market, the deal will see a selection of Swintt’s slot content taken live on the operator’s igaming service, including titles in the SwinttPremium range. 

Claiming to have proven popularity in the German market, the SwinttPremium range offers a collection of classically-themed slot titles to appeal to traditional slot fans. 

Games in the SwinttPremium range include Seven Seven Pots and Pearls and Extra Win X. 

Lars Kollind, Head of Business Development at Swintt, commented: “Swintt – and in particular, the studio’s SwinttPremium catalogue of games – is already very popular in Germany, so we’re thrilled to have the opportunity to connect with new audiences via Jackpotpiraten.de. 

“We’re sure the collaboration will be a big success and we can’t wait to see how our slots perform with players.”

The deal will also include titles from Swintt’s recently-launched studio subsidiary, Elysium Studios. This will see Jackpotpiraten.de players able to spin the reels on slots such as Elysium VIP and Law of Gilgamesh.
